A) Outside air at 5C and 40% relative humidity is heated at 25C and final relative humidity is raised to 40% while the temperature remains constant by introducing steam at 400kPa into the airstream. Determine the following:

a. Draw this process on a psychrometric chart
b. Find the needed rate of heat transfer if the incoming volume flow rate of air is 60m3min
c. Calculate the rate of steam supplied
d. Calculate the state of the steam introduced
B) Water is used to remove the heat from the condenser of a power plant. 12,000kgmin at 40C water enters a cooling tower. Water leaves it at 25C. Air enters the cooling tower at 20C,50% relative humidity and leaves it at 32C,98% relative humidity. Estimate the following:

a. The volume flow rate of air into the cooling tower
b. Mass flow rate of water that leaves the cooling tower from the bottom
